I doubt that your modules are defective. Maybe you have the opportunity to test the modules in a SB32/AWE32 card (The DOS based DIAG tool tests the cards DRAM).
I just ran MAUIDIAG on one of my Mauis:
After loading the DIAGMAUI.MOT firmware the program performed the tests and displayed no errors. The test machine was an AT&T Globalyst Socket 4 computer with Pentium 66. PCI / VLB / ISA type, non PnP. MAUIs addresses are set to 330h / i2/9 (standard). The tested memory were two different sets, 2x 4MB modules each, one 3 chip configuration (with parity), 60ns and one 9 chip configuration (with parity), 70ns. One pair had gold plated contacts, one pair had tin plated contacts. With both pairs the reported memory size was: 8650752 bytes.
Literally "hours" later, all tests were "passed OK".

According to FAQ there may be problems with memory slower than 70 ns:
h) What kind of SIMMs can the Maui use?
The Maui uses 30 pin, 9 or 3 chip SIMMs (Standard PC 30 pin SIMMs),
70 ns or faster. Slower SIMMS (ie, >70ns) may or may not work.
The Maui requires parity, according to Turtle Beach (ie, no 2 chip
or 8 chip SIMMs, the kind Macintoshes use)
Although ICS2115 specification says that 80ns is acceptable:
It seems that a maximum of 4Mb per memory stick is supported. So, I can't just grab a 16Mb stick and have all the 8 Mb of sample RAM.

First of all, the WaveFront synthesizer was made 1st as a Sampler inspired by this, 2nd as a Editable Synthesizer, 3rd General MIDI compatible Synth with the possibility of downloading sound banks.
This 3rd priority is what you are trying to achieve.
So this task is not easy due the design in mind of these cards.
A few tips/things:
Yes, one midi instrument (except drums channel) can be made up to 4 layers of .wavs, layers can sound simultaneously or be spread that will take 4 sampling slots.
In the drums channel you can place any .wav in any key.
The "normal" process to create a new instrument in a WaveFront ICS would be:
raw wav --> Wave SE editor --> upload to synt --> WavePath to adjust different settings --> save WFP or WFB --> use WF control panel to load next time you want to use the bank or the DOS utility.
WaveSE looks like a .wav editor but it also can send that edited wav into the Synths ram directly. SO it's an important tool (you can only set loop points using this and it can also add effects)
First just try a Drum Kit it's easier to handle:
Get a decent Roland 808 or 909 sound font, convert it with Awave to .WFD upload it using WF control panel or WavePatch.
Try it with some game midis
one more thing:
if you really really really really really want a GM compatible sound bank to replace the Voice Crystal on the Turtles, the best way is to do it manually with Wavepatch, one instrument at a time, it's really not that hard at least for me. You can cut corners by converting a ready made GM bank and then again (can't stress this enough) using WavePatch the debug the missing/wrong sounding instruments.
You've got to learn how to use WavePatch 1.3
